--- Comment #1 from Detlev Casanova <detlev casanova gmail com>  2009-07-28 10:38:06 ---
Yes, it should, thanks for noticing but it would not solve your problem for
multiple reasons.
First, the Google Talk client still works with the old (Google) version of the
Jingle protocol, Kopete works with a pre-version of the new (XMPP) one.

Then, Kopete does not implement any NAT and firewall traversal transport. That
means that you have to manually enter your public IP and redirect (and open) 
the necessary ports to your computer. I'm not even sure that the Google client
will manage to make a connection like that.

And Finally, the sound implementation is really weak (voice will be cut every
second) so you won't really ear what your friend is saying.

That's the reasons why it will be disabled in kde 4.3 and reactivated when I
will have enough time to work on it (actually, it will be as soon as school
starts again :-) )
